Have you had an IHHE Moment?

I am the youngest of six boys in my family.  There are no sisters.

You can imagine the state of chaos that our family was in most times.  Six boys smashing, pounding, beating, trashing, yelling, and generally misbehaving at all times.

When times got particularly out of control, my mother would have an IHHE Moment.  She would announce (to no one in particular) in a LOUD voice – "I Have Had Enough!!!"  She had an IHHE Moment.

I can tell you this from experience – when mom had an IHHE Moment, things were changing!  Life as we knew it was OVER!

I wonder today if you have had an IHHE Moment with your financial situation.  Have you had enough?  Are you sick and tired of never having enough money to pay all of the bills on time?  Are you sick and tired of falling behind on the house payment?  Maybe you are not able to invest money because of the amount of debt you have.

My IHHE moment was in December 2002.  My first ever blog post relates some of the story.

Here are some characteristics of IHHE Moments:

  • Change happens
  • It is an emotional event
  • Everyone around that person KNOWS that an IHHE Moment has occurred
